logo

DeepSeek从入门到精通:清华大学开源项目详解与实战指南

作者:暴富20212025.08.20 21:21浏览量:0

简介:本文深入解析清华大学开源的DeepSeek项目,涵盖核心功能、应用场景及技术优势,并提供详尽的图文使用手册PDF免费获取方式。从基础安装到高级应用,帮助开发者快速掌握这一强大工具。

DeepSeek从入门到精通:清华大学开源项目详解与实战指南

一、DeepSeek项目背景与清华大学开源意义

DeepSeek作为清华大学重点孵化的开源项目,代表了中国高校在信息检索与知识挖掘领域的前沿研究成果。该项目采用先进的深度学习自然语言处理技术,具备以下核心特性:

  1. 多模态检索能力:支持文本、图像、视频的跨模态搜索
  2. 分布式架构设计:基于微服务的弹性扩展方案
  3. 知识图谱集成:内置百万级实体关系的知识网络

清华大学选择开源该项目,标志着中国顶尖学府在促进技术民主化方面的重大突破,为开发者社区提供了工业级检索系统的参考实现。

二、DeepSeek核心架构解析(含技术示意图)

2.1 系统架构设计

  1. # 伪代码展示核心处理流程
  2. def deepseek_query_processing(query):
  3. # 查询理解层
  4. parsed_query = NLP_parser(query)
  5. # 检索执行层
  6. results = vector_search(parsed_query) + keyword_search(parsed_query)
  7. # 结果融合与排序
  8. ranked_results = learning_to_rank(results)
  9. return ranked_results[:10]

2.2 关键技术组件

  • 倒排索引引擎:采用改进的Roaring Bitmap压缩技术
  • 向量检索模块:基于Faiss优化的近似最近邻搜索
  • 查询理解模型:融合BERT和传统检索特征的混合模型

三、超详细使用手册PDF内容概览

手册包含200+页实战内容,主要章节包括:

  1. 环境搭建(含Docker/Kubernetes部署方案)
  2. API接口详解(REST/gRPC双协议支持)
  3. 性能调优指南(QPS提升50%的实战技巧)
  4. 企业级应用案例(电商搜索/内容审核等场景)

PDF获取方式:访问清华大学开源软件镜像站(具体URL),或关注「DeepSeek开源社区」公众号回复「手册」获取

四、典型应用场景与Benchmark数据

4.1 电商搜索场景

指标 DeepSeek 基线系统
召回率@10 92.3% 85.7%
响应延迟 78ms 120ms

4.2 企业知识管理

  • 支持PDF/PPT/Word等多格式文档检索
  • 基于ACL权限的细粒度访问控制

五、进阶开发指南

5.1 插件开发规范

  1. // 自定义排序插件示例
  2. public class MyRanker implements RankPlugin {
  3. @Override
  4. public double score(Document doc, Query query) {
  5. return BM25(doc, query) * freshnessBoost(doc);
  6. }
  7. }

5.2 性能优化checklist

  1. 索引分片策略:建议每节点不超过5个主分片
  2. JVM配置:G1垃圾回收器 + 堆内存不超过物理内存50%
  3. 查询预热:对高频查询建立预编译模板

六、社区支持与学习路径

  • 官方资源:GitHub仓库含100+示例项目
  • 学习曲线
    • 初级:掌握REST API调用(1周)
    • 中级:理解扩展机制(1个月)
    • 高级:参与核心开发(3个月+)

结语

DeepSeek作为国产开源检索系统的标杆项目,其技术深度和易用性已达到工业级应用标准。建议开发者从官方手册入门,逐步深入内核机制,最终实现定制化开发。项目持续更新中,欢迎加入开源社区共同建设。

(全文共计1580字,包含6大核心模块和12个技术子项详解)

相关文章推荐

发表评论